Flat 50, 85 Fairfield Road, London, E3 2QF is a leasehold flat built between 1996-2002. The property offers approximately 549 square feet of living space and is situated on the 3rd flo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£382,143 , which equates to approximately £696 per square foot. It was last sold on 1 Sep 2006 for £214,781. Since then, the value has increased by £167,362, representing a 77.9% increase, or approximately 4.0% per year.

The current estimated value of £382,143 is:

  • 17.2% lower than the average property price on Fairfield Road
  • 9.4% lower than the average in the E3 2QF postcode area
  • and 56.3% lower than the average price for London as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 7 July 2021,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

Flat 50, 85 Fairfield Road, London, Tower Hamlets, Greater London, E3 2QF has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 7 Jul 2021.

This property uses electric room heaters as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from off-peak electric immersion heater.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 22 Jun 2011. The rating of C rem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 2.6%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from electric storage heaters to room heaters, electric, changing energy efficiency from average to very poor.
  • The hot water energy efficiency changing from average to poor, while the system remained as electric immersion, off-peak.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 12%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 91%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from poor to very good.
